It’s no secret that having a clean home is important. Clean windows and mirrors can make a room look brighter and more inviting. However, cleaning glass surfaces can be tricky. Using cloths to clean your glass and mirrors can leave streaks, smudges, and lint behind. That’s why newspaper is the perfect material for window and mirror cleaning.

The newspaper is a very dense material, so it has soft fibers that make it non-abrasive, perfect for glass and window cleaning. Newspaper also has a slippery feel that helps it glide smoothly over surfaces without scratching or smearing them.

If you’re looking to clean your windows and mirrors without leaving behind any streaks or smudges, here’s what you need to do:

Step 1: Take an empty spray bottle and fill it with 50% white vinegar and 50% water. This combination of ingredients serves as a natural cleaning solution that will help you get rid of dirt and grime on your windows and mirrors.

Step 2: Shake the bottle well and spray the mixture onto the glass surface.

Step 3: Use your newspaper to wipe down the surface. The newspaper will help you remove any dirt and grime that was left behind.

By following these steps, you’ll be able to get your windows and mirrors looking as good as new.
